Mivan and Lagan drop merger plans

9 Jan 14 Two of Northern Ireland’s leading construction contractors have ended discussions about a merger without reaching a deal.

According to BBC reports, Mivan and Lagan Group Holdings had been in talks about joining together. However, these talks have now concluded with no agreement being reached.

Both companies are privately owned. Belfast-based Lagan Group Holdings, owned by Kevin Lagan, is a diverse quarrying, cement, building materials, house building and civil engineering Group of companies.

Antrim-based Mivan, founded by its chief executive Ivan McCabrey in 1975, is more focused on high-end fit-out projects.

A planned merger between Lagan Cement and part of the Quinn Group was called off last year when Kevin Lagan received a bullet in the post.
